As per the Constitution, the Aim of Birdlip and Brimpsfield Playgroup is to enhance the development, care and education of children, primarily under statutory school age, and also of children and young people of school age by encouraging parents to understand and provide for the need of their children through community (voluntary managed) groups and by:
Summary of the objects of the charity set out in its governing document
-
a) Offering appropriate play facilities and training courses, together with the right of parents to take responsibility for and to become involved in the activities of such groups, ensuring that such groups offer opportunities for all children and young people, whatever their race, culture, religion, means or ability;
-
b) Encouraging the study of the needs of such children and their families and promoting public interest in and recognition of such needs in the local area; and
-
c) Instigating and adhering to and furthering the Aim of PATA.

Birdlip and Brimpsfield Playgroup is a small community playgroup Summary of the main offering three morning sessions a week for children aged 2 to 5 years. In achievements of the charity addition, the staff run Breakfast Club in association with Birdlip School. during the year
The main achievements for the last year were:
-
Continuing to provide a safe and friendly learning environment throughout the year. All staff are DBS checked and have relevant up-to-date first aid training.
-
Continuing to improve the financial position of the playgroup 3. Continuing to improve the outdoor play and learning space. Playgroup uses the local school’s playground for the outdoor space and continues to ensure that toys are maintained and the area safe and fun to use.

Brief statement of the charity’s policy on reserves
We are looking to build up a reserve, to be set at the equivalent of a terms running costs (approx. £12,000). To achieve this, we are aiming to set aside £500 each term (£1,500 pa) into our deposit account to build our reserves again.
